summaryrefslogtreecommitdiff
path: root/config/chroot_local-includes
diff options
context:
space:
mode:
authorHolger Paradies <retabell@gmx.de>2013-03-04 20:14:12 +0100
committerAndreas Loibl <andreas@andreas-loibl.de>2013-03-04 22:33:41 +0100
commit42a955c1a23da766033369a1b600df2295ebcecf (patch)
tree47541a9e33d7c05e50fbcf62a4e92dd90de5ff2f /config/chroot_local-includes
parent2a15df271b4542ae8f4230fbb8a84cd5333be114 (diff)
downloadkanotix-42a955c1a23da766033369a1b600df2295ebcecf.zip
kanotix-42a955c1a23da766033369a1b600df2295ebcecf.tar.gz
disable-compiz-per-bootcmd-on-live
Diffstat (limited to 'config/chroot_local-includes')
-rwxr-xr-xconfig/chroot_local-includes/lib/live/config/9023-disable-compiz26
1 files changed, 26 insertions, 0 deletions
diff --git a/config/chroot_local-includes/lib/live/config/9023-disable-compiz b/config/chroot_local-includes/lib/live/config/9023-disable-compiz
new file mode 100755
index 0000000..565a92c
--- /dev/null
+++ b/config/chroot_local-includes/lib/live/config/9023-disable-compiz
@@ -0,0 +1,26 @@
+#!/bin/sh
+
+Nocompiz ()
+{
+ # Checking if configured
+ if [ -e /var/lib/live/config/nocompiz ]
+ then
+ return
+ fi
+ echo -n " nocompiz"
+ Configure_nocompiz
+}
+
+Configure_nocompiz ()
+{
+ # Boot parameters can be acted up either this way...
+ if ! grep -qs "nocompiz" /proc/cmdline
+ then
+ return
+ fi
+ rm -f /home/${LIVE_USERNAME}/.config/autostart/compiz_start.desktop
+ # Creating state file
+ touch /var/lib/live/config/nocompiz
+}
+
+Nocompiz